Postmortem timeline — Lintgate baseline drift

09:41 — The static-analysis baseline file for the Corvess payments service was regenerated by an unattended job, suppressing 34 previously flagged findings. 10:05 — On-call noticed the shrunken finding count and froze merges. 10:30 — Baseline restored from the prior revision; suppressed findings re-triaged, none exploitable. For audit purposes, the job that rewrote the baseline can be matched against the trace token recorded below.

trace token, faduf-hahig: htk4_b8f9

Ticket: Door sensor recall — Quallen Systems has recalled the QS-40 proximity sensors fitted to doors in the Hazelmere Annex. Until replacements arrive, those doors will not auto-release, and new starters should expect a short delay at each entry point. Please do not force or wedge the doors open, as this triggers a site-wide alert. Engineers from Quallen will be on site through Friday. In the meantime, all affected doors can be opened manually using the fallback code below.

staff pass of kawip-hawef = bdg-QLP-2

If a payment retry on Paylume returns a duplicate-charge warning, first confirm the client sent the same idempotency key on every attempt. Keys expire after 24 hours; a reused key after expiry creates a fresh charge, which is usually the root cause. Replay the request through the sandbox verifier to confirm. For sandbox access, authenticate using the bearer token below.

session JWT of yawep-yawep = eyJhbGciOiJIUzI1NiIsInR5cCI6IkpXVCJ9.eyJzdWIiOiI3pWF3_In0.aXYsHiog